As of September 2026, the MLS records 1 closed sale in Fiskes in Jacksonville, FL, the most recent in December 2014. Across Jacksonville as a whole, 8,811 homes closed in the last 12 months at a median of $310,000, 44 median days on market, with 2,375 homes for sale today. At that median and Duval County's FY2025-26 rate of 17.86 mills, annual property tax runs about $5,540 ($4,800 with the full homestead exemption).

The market around Fiskes
Fiskes is too small for its own price trend, so here is the market around it.
In ZIP 32208, 206 homes are on the market and 25% are under contract — a steady corner of Jacksonville.
Across Duval County, 3,938 homes are active and 1,658 pending (30% under contract).
ZIP and county figures describe the wider market, not Fiskes specifically. Momentum Research analysis of MLS records.

The Fiskes buying strategy.
If we were buying in Fiskes today, this is the order of operations we would run for our clients.
Underwrite the condition first. Price the roof, HVAC, and systems honestly before judging any list price; condition swings value here more than square footage alone.
Match the home to real comps. Recent sales of similar condition and lot, not the asking price, tell you what a home is worth.
Move deliberately, not desperately. Neither side has a decisive edge, so a well-prepared, fairly-priced offer wins without overpaying.
Line up financing and inspection early. A pre-approval and an inspection plan let you act fast and negotiate from evidence.

A property-by-property market
The defining trait of Fiskes is scale: it's a compact part of Jacksonville, not a large master-planned community. Small areas like this rarely produce enough recent, like-for-like sales to establish a reliable price pattern, so buyers and sellers alike should expect to build their case from individual comps in and around the area rather than from a neighborhood average.
That isn't a negative — it's a posture. It rewards people who do the homework: pull the comparable sales, look hard at condition, and weigh location within Duval County against alternatives nearby. If you want a number handed to you off a dashboard, this isn't that; if you're willing to underwrite a specific address, there can be opportunity in an area the crowds overlook.
